OpenGL – Build high performance graphics

What You Will Learn:

  • Off-screen rendering and environment mapping techniques to render mirrors
  • Shadow mapping techniques, including variance shadow mapping
  • Implement a particle system using shaders
  • Utilize noise in shaders
  • Make use of compute shaders for physics, animation, and general computing
  • Create interactive applications using GLFW to handle user inputs and the Android Sensor framework to detect gestures and motions on mobile devices
  • Use OpenGL primitives to plot 2-D datasets (such as time series) dynamically
  • Render complex 3D volumetric datasets with techniques such as data slicers and multiple viewpoint projection
